A scaled version means that our leading coefficient will change. Let's set up an equation to find our leading coefficient, a.

g(x) = a * x^2

Now that we have our equation, we need a point that is on g(x). The point given is (4,8). Let's use that point and plug x and y into our equation so that we can solve for a.

8 = a * (4)^2

8 = a * 16

a = 1/2

All that's left to do is plug in our a value into g(x).

g(x) = 1/2 x^2
